Core Viewpoint - The article discusses the release of the "Guiding Opinions on Promoting the Efficient Transformation of Individual Businesses into Enterprises" by nine government departments, aimed at facilitating the transformation of individual businesses into enterprises and enhancing support for this transition. Group 1: Policy Implementation - The "Guiding Opinions" emphasize the importance of respecting the wishes of individual business owners and enhancing the integration of government services to provide standardized and efficient support for the transformation process [1][3] - The document outlines two methods for the transformation process: direct change and "cancellation + establishment," allowing for a streamlined registration process [2][3] Group 2: Support Measures - The opinions propose a classification-based support system for individual businesses, focusing on "growth-type," "development-type," and "special and excellent" businesses to encourage their transformation into enterprises [2] - A transitional period is suggested to ease the transformation process, allowing businesses to maintain their original invoice limits and extending existing management and incentive measures during this time [3] Group 3: Voluntary Transformation - The guiding principles stress the voluntary nature of the transformation, ensuring that individual business owners are not coerced or incentivized against their will to transition into enterprises [3]
